Renowned tattoo artist Ami James leaves the warm beaches and artistic eccentricity of Miami for the hustle and bustle of New York City. In the heart of SoHo, Ami opens his new studio, Wooster St. Social Club – the primary setting for TLC's reality series, NY Ink. This captivating series aired from 2011 to 2013, providing a uniquely stylized and intimate glimpse into the world of tattoo artistry. Each episode reveals the complex inner workings of a busy New York tattoo studio, while showcasing a colorful cast of personalities that make up the artistic workforce. At the helm is Ami James, a veteran tattoo artist originally featured on another popular TLC series, 'Miami Ink.' With years of experience under his belt and a burning passion for his craft, Ami's decision to start anew in the Big Apple poses significant challenges beyond wielding the tattoo needle. His dedication to creating the best tattoo parlor in NYC, intertwined with his everyday struggles, forms the crux of the series. In addition to highlighting the introspective tattoos and intricate designs created by the artists, NY Ink also paints a detailed picture of the world within the shop itself, focusing on the interpersonal dynamics among the staff. The show features a cast of characters with distinctive personalities, styles, and experiences. Alongside Ami James, tattoo artists including Tim Hendricks, Chris Torres, and Megan Massacre lend their talent and unequivocal flair to the series. The clashing of artistic visions, personal philosophies, and robust egos often lead to compelling interpersonal conflicts, loaded with raw emotions and high stakes. As an authority on the business's artistic side, Ami must also wield his entrepreneurial skills to keep the shop profitable and functioning smoothly. The pressures of managing a crew with divergent personalities, balancing the financial aspects, and maintaining the shop's reputation often stretch Ami's cool persona. NY Ink is a series categorized as a canceled/ended. Spanning 3 seasons with a total of 24 episodes, the show debuted on 2011. The series has earned a moderate reviews from both critics and viewers. The IMDb score stands at 6.6.
